Venezuela recently experienced two powerful earthquakes, both measuring 7.0 on the Richter scale, occurring in quick succession near Yumare. This seismic doublet, a rare geological occurrence, underscores the region's complex tectonic dynamics, where stress transfer along fault lines can trigger simultaneous seismic events, revealing the intricacies of the Earth's crust in this area.

Scientific updates

The U.S. Geological Survey noted that the earthquakes originated at a depth of approximately 10 kilometers, indicating their potential for widespread impact. Researchers are examining the stress transfer mechanisms involved, drawing parallels with similar seismic doublets observed globally, such as those in Turkey and Syria.

Future outlook

Given the geological characteristics of the region, there is a 5% probability of a significant aftershock occurring within the week. This highlights the ongoing seismic risks that Venezuela faces, necessitating continued monitoring and preparedness.

Earth's undiscovered wonder

Did you know that seismic doublets, like the recent earthquakes in Venezuela, occur when two quakes happen in rapid succession along different fault lines? This phenomenon, while rare, offers scientists valuable insights into how stress is transferred in the Earth's crust, potentially leading to better predictions of future seismic activity.
